Frequently Asked Questions About Substance Abuse Treatment in Eagle County, CO

What is the cost of substance abuse treatment in Eagle County, CO, and are there any financial assistance options available?

The cost of substance abuse treatment in Eagle County, CO varies widely depending on the type of program and facility. Some treatment centers offer financial assistance or sliding-scale fees based on income. It's advisable to inquire about payment options and potential assistance during the admission process.

What is the success rate of substance abuse treatment in Eagle County, CO?

The success rate of substance abuse treatment varies among individuals and depends on factors like the type of addiction, the commitment to treatment, and post-treatment support. Treatment centers often provide statistics on their success rates, but individual outcomes may differ.

Are there specialized treatment programs for specific substances like opioids, alcohol, or stimulants in Eagle County, CO?

Yes, there are specialized treatment programs in Eagle County tailored to specific substances. For instance, opioid addiction may require medication-assisted treatment (MAT), while alcohol addiction may involve detoxification and counseling. Choose a program that addresses the substance of concern.

What qualifications should I look for in substance abuse treatment staff?

Qualified substance abuse treatment staff typically have credentials such as licensed addiction counselors (LAC), certified alcohol and drug counselors (CADC), or relevant degrees in psychology or social work. Additionally, experienced and compassionate professionals can make a significant difference in your recovery journey.

How can I support a family member or friend who is seeking substance abuse treatment in Eagle County, CO?

Supporting a loved one in their journey to recovery involves offering emotional support, attending family therapy sessions if available, and educating yourself about addiction. Encourage their commitment to treatment, avoid enabling behaviors, and be patient throughout the process.

What are the signs of a reputable substance abuse treatment center in Eagle County, CO?

Reputable treatment centers are often accredited, licensed, and staffed by qualified professionals. They provide a comprehensive treatment approach, offer individualized treatment plans, maintain a clean and safe environment, and have positive reviews and testimonials from former clients.

Can I continue working or attending school while undergoing substance abuse treatment in Eagle County, CO?

Some outpatient treatment programs in Eagle County, Colorado are designed to accommodate work or school commitments, while inpatient programs may require a temporary hiatus. Discuss your situation with the treatment center to find a program that suits your needs and responsibilities.

What is the role of family therapy in substance abuse treatment?

Family therapy plays a vital role in substance abuse treatment by addressing family dynamics, improving communication, and involving loved ones in the recovery process. It helps create a supportive and understanding environment, contributing to the individual's successful recovery.

Is there a waiting list for admission to substance abuse treatment programs in Eagle County, Colorado?

Waiting lists can vary depending on the treatment center's capacity and demand. It's advisable to contact treatment centers in advance, assess their availability, and plan accordingly to minimize potential delays in starting your treatment.
